Org-mode pdf export template

Annotated bibliography template for a printed annotated bibliography. This was all a bit cumbersome, so i created simple org mode export templates. Standard manuscript formatted pdf export from org mode. Table template for orgmode pdf export stack overflow. You may switch between the default style provided by emacs org mode, i. Previously, i used the builtin opml templates and then converted the output to org mode using pandoc. Top level headline second level third level some text third level more text another top level headline the name defined inorgfootnotesection is reserved. I want to take notes with it and have source code blocks. Im having difficulty in changing the export template. I am on osx, installed last version of mactex 2017 distribution, the full one and i have currently no problem to export a verybasic org file no headers or options. I try to export a org file into pdf file with moderncv as document class. This document provides examples of different things that can be done in emacs orgmode files. When you want to export to pdf, you do the same thing. Browse our collection of professionally designed layouts you can personalize and print in minutes.

There are many ways to customize pandoc to fit your needs, including a template system and a powerful system for writing filters. I have a pretty good org mode setup for creating pdfs so i wanted the output to be org mode files. The library includes separate modules for each input and output format, so adding a new input or output format just requires adding a new module. So if you do have a company template for arbitrary word files, you could use it as a template for your export. Ive found orgmode great for early phases of writing.

Export into pdf a moderncv orgmode file mactex tex. I did zero configuration on orgmode and when i try to export this file. It enforces a really clear boundary between write your words and make the output look pretty. The org mode variable orglatexpdfprocess holds a list of strings, each of which is run as a shell command.

The headlines in org start with one or more stars, on the left margin1. Using template files for pandoc exports to word or. However, the solution to export html and pdf is not straightforward. Org mode is a builtin emacs extension that helps you keep notes, maintain todo lists, manage projects, and author documents with a fast and effective plaintext system. Elf letter template free templates looking for templates for crafts, scrapbooking or any other project. Id like my tables to be the same width 75% text width in my org pdf export. This page is about managing todo lists and publishing website using emacs and orgmode tutorial, manual, example. This is a really pleasant and efficient way to create documents, but when working on a long document, it can take several seconds for emacs to compile the exported latex to pdf. The document is intended to be output as a pdf file and distributed as printed hard copy. Every month i export my tinderbox daybook entries so that i can print and bind them a whole other story.

Daily lesson plan template pdf looking for templates for crafts, scrapbooking or. The template is designed to be selfexplanatory since the documentation for it consists of a sample course developed with this template. Template for a printed annotated bibliography plos one template for a plos one journal article. Though you can easily override css stylesheets and add your own html themes, we can say or write that org mode provides a basic html support orghmtl themes is an open source framework for providing you with a list of very nice crossbrowser themes for all your org documents. Im starting to use orgmode to export text to latex my problem is that it opens the generated pdf with ebookviewer it is a epub, chm reader instead of using evince question. This article serves as a complete demonstration for my org. Org can convert and export documents to a variety of other formats while retaining as much structure see document structure and markup see markup for rich contents as possible. Option keyword sets tailored to a particular backend can be inserted from the export dispatcher see the export dispatcher using the insert template.

The previous posts covered structuring your notes and adding tables and links and images, and formatting text and source code. Use of templates in org mode of emacs tex latex stack exchange. Capture templates, define the outline of different note types. Typically, several commands are needed to process a latex document to produce pdf output. Does anyone know how to change this behaviour and configure evince to be the default viewer. I started using orgmode on spacemacs i use this emacs macport version of emacs since the normal one had issues like screen flickering and crashing on quitting a frame. En outre, il dispose dexcellents outils dexportation, entre autres vers pdf latex, vers beamer, vers html et vers odt libreoffice. Latex export lets you use org mode and its structured editing functions. This post is a continuation of building a second brain with emacs and orgmode. Just like in the days when i used latex, working in plain text doesnt details of pagination or formatting distract me.

Working with source code, export, evaluate, and tangle code blocks. Latex export, exporting to latex, and processing to pdf. Our template mechanism translates a template file into a lisp function that is used by orgpublish to produce the actual output. The easiest way to get a pdf in smf out of org mode seemed to be the latex exporter. Implementing a second brain in emacs and orgmode tasshin. I would highly recommend to read the orgmode manual for latex exporting capabilities. Xoxo export org files to xoxo files freemind export org files to freemind files. Ascii export produces a readable and simple version of an org file for printing and sharing notes. However, this replaces my directory list with a list of explicit filenames instead and is not what i want. The orgcoursepack provides a template for developing and managing teaching materials using org mode, a major mode in gnu emacs. Julia notebook functionality works out of the box thanks to objulia. Use of templates in org mode of emacs tex latex stack.

These forms are integrated into a lambda function that defines all the local variables and does some preprocessing of the input. Pandoc includes a haskell library and a standalone commandline program. Make beautiful documents from emacs orgmode linux hint. Probably the most useful to begin with are web pages and pdf via latex but more are available. Is direct conversion to pdf and printing the pdf so generated is possible or i have to go through the cycle org latex pdf manually. Org mode for emacs your life in plain text hacker news.

To export this file to a web page, type cc ce to start the exporter and then press h to select html and o to select open. It gave a high level overview of how basb extends gtd, what emacs and orgmode are and why i wanted to implement basb with them. Contribute to literatedevopsliterateprogrammingtutorials development by creating an account on github. A massive benefit of org mode, then, is that i can write my notes, meeting minutes, todos and even latexpdf papers as well as track time right there in org mode, with consistent shortcuts and consistent emphasis markup. Take your reports from boring to brilliant with customizable templates from canva. Libreoffices export to pdf has this option fileexport as pdfpdfa1a if you change the preferences in the ui, i am not sure whether it will kicked in with command line export. This will generate something that looks like this some specific entries will vary.

The function templatedhtmlloadtemplate loads the template file into an emacs buffer and uses the parser to generate a list of forms. How can i use following template in an org mode on latex. The latex pdf export should log its output to a buffer called org pdf latex output. Using the latest and greatest homebrewemacshead now finally doomwilmersdorf works out the box something like two years ago to track projects for my phd. The thing is, what if you want to use xelatex to process your files, rather than pdflatex. In this post, i am going to show you how to do something that has long escaped me.

To interrupt orglatexpdfprocess to regexpreplace some string of the. Use emacs org mode to easily create latex documents. The orgmode manual says latex export is controlled by the orgexporttopdfprocess variable. There is only one small oddity, it starts with latex. This file describes a template for creating an annotated bibliography document using org mode. I should mention, making seperate files to export to pdf and html seems redundant and not in the nature in orgmode. One strength of orgmode is the ability to export to multiple formats.

I like it because it is very good at exporting files to various formats, especially pdf via latex and html. According to the manual, the option referencedocfile may define a docx word or odt libreoffice document which is used as a format template file. First, we need to define some of the latexboilerplate, and. A quick read through the orgmode code got this sorted. The examples should provide a clue of what you need to look up in the org mode manual. How to export org mode files into awesome html in 2 minutes overview description. Annotated bibliography template org mode for emacs. Exporting your notes in this final post of my short series on using orgmode to write rich, structured notes, we will look at exporting the notes as a web page or pdf document. A better option is to figure out how to export the org file to an org file, and transform the org citation links to pandoc citations, then use pandoc on the temporarily transformed buffer. The way op is adding paragraphs are not needed, leaving an empty line will should automattically do it afik. Still using it now but it felt like a good time to. Change style of orgmode export to pdf emacs stack exchange. At some point you might want to print your notes, publish them on the web, or share them with people not using org.

To paste a template of all export options in your org document so that you can set them immediately. I am a daily orgmode user though, and orgmode can export to latex which then, in turn, are translated into pdfs. I usually write reports for my employees in orgmode and export them to pdf via. That way, you keep the cite links and their functionality, and ability to export to many formats, and get export to docx via pandoc. This document provides examples of different things that can be done in emacs org mode files.

Exporting my tinderbox daybook to org mode jack batys. If this occurs then adding a new org file to any of the above directories will not contribute to my agenda and i will probably miss something important. A few hints are given for managing an agenda and publishing to latex, but i am not using it for myself. The styles used by orgmode to export specific parts of your document can be set in your stylesheet with the following variables. This project provides a template to export an org mode file to a latex.

1075 412 913 1082 1463 971 512 1074 487 384 1211 519 601 1007 388 447 1534 682 1368 387 282 726 568 1035 888 992 1344 241 544 243 77 1048 495 327 1304 412 729 864 577 1344 79 465 282 394 926